SOU celebrates 100th Commencement

Southern Oregon University’s 2026 Commencement ceremony on Saturday, June 13, celebrated nearly 600 new graduates who earned a total of more than 900 degrees.

The ceremony – the 100th since the university reopened at its current location in 1926, following a lengthy hiatus – was at Raider Stadium, at Webster and Wightman streets in Ashland. It began with an 8:45 a.m. processional and lasted for about two hours.

The event featured a color guard from the Oregon National Guard and Eagle Staff from the SOU Native American Student Union. Graduating senior Acacia Cook sang the national anthem.

SOU Executive Vice President and Provost Casey Shillam served as the master of ceremonies. President Rick Bailey offered brief remarks, and Jocelyn Gallegos Vargas followed as the student commencement speaker.

Gallegos Vargas, a first-generation Latina student, graduated with a bachelor’s degree in Business Administration and Spanish Language and Culture. She served as president of the Latino Student Union, worked at Rogue Credit Union’s campus branch and participated in the Global Innovation Scholars Program.

She plans to continue her work with Rogue Credit Union following graduation, serving as a community outreach and financial education coordinator.
